[SIE] 37, Call Options - Rights and Strategies
from Open Exam Prep
This podcast is made by Ran Chen, who holds an EA license, Insurance and Securities licenses (Series 6, 63, 65), and CFP designation. He is passionate about opening up information to help everyone prepare better for financial certification exams. This episode covers content for the SIE Exam. In this episode you will learn: - The fundamental right of a call option buyer to purchase a stock at a set strike price. - How to calculate maximum gain, maximum loss, and breakeven for a long call position. - The motivations and unlimited risk associated with writing a naked (uncovered) call. - How a covered call strategy works to generate income on an existing stock position. - A simple mnemonic, "Call Up," to remember the breakeven formula and bullish sentiment for call buyers.
